Nice bar/restaurant with different types of seating on the ground floor of the Renaissance Zurich Tower Hotel. The dining space is fairly large and can accommodate groups as well. The personnel is very attentive, quick and friendly. The menu offers a relative good selection of food. I found the food I ordered really good and the portions were properly sized. It is not very cheap, but I supposed it is not surprising for a hotel's restaurant.

It is a fairly quiet place, and usually you would not go to a hotel to have dinner. But the cook understands his business really well here, the meet was done to perfection, bleu meaning bleu, nice fries, great fish tartar to start. The prices are as usual in Zurich: high, but the dishes deserve the price. I'd give 5 stars for that. What fails to impress is the service. It starts at the hotel reception, no one speaks Swiss German to start with and there is some lame excuse of why something is not possible, it's like a child giving a justification. But it comes worse. At the table the service is friendly, no doubt, but it is so push that it is to mask that the waiters have no formal education on their job. They will happily reach over the neighbour's plate to take the plate away or put something down. They will constantly try to push you to order while the restaurant is not busy. The waiter had no clue about wines, not the faintest, I think it was the first time he heard that there years indicated on bottles. So while they don't lack friendliness, they are just dilettantes and painful to watch. A bit a pity as the food deserves coming here.
